Transaction 80bd80109accdfd9a8f6c5826f94bd147a8d79fb6559547cae892c9651e64d4b
1 Input
1 Output
-
80bd80109accdfd9a8f6c5826f94bd147a8d79fb6559547cae892c9651e64d4b:0
- value
- 342131
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5efb90f1a9a743bf6ca49fb0efdf6f5a139c166 OP_EQUAL
- address
- 3Q7QenDT1TLMxPJ455J2GvogAMprYAua86